Australia and the Philippines had a massive brawl in the third quarter of a FIBA World Cup qualifying.

An elbow thrown by Philippines player June Mar Fajardo turned into an all-out brawl.

Punches and chairs were thrown as players and spectators got involved.

Thon Maker entered the situation trying to defend his teammates and break things up.

Maker was punched in the back of the head by Terrence Bill Romeo of the Philippines. Maker responded by charging at Romeo and kicking at him with his left leg. 

Thirteen players were ejected with four from Australia and nine from the Philippines.  

The Philippines were forced to play with just three players and when Gabe Norwood fouled out, just one players was left for the Philippines and the game was stopped.
